Arlen is a given name, with more bearers in the United States than in any other country. It appears chiefly in English and Portuguese, written in the Latin script. Recorded meaning: an alteration of the German surname Erlen.

Frequently asked questions

How common is the name Arlen?
We estimate roughly 103 thousand people bear Arlen (counting its spellings and scripts) across 12 countries in our records.
In which country does Arlen have the most bearers?
We estimate about 85 thousand people bear Arlen in the United States, more than in any other country in our records, where it is most often spelled arlen.
Where is Arlen most common?
Measured as a share of residents rather than as a count, Arlen is densest in Guyana — about 1 in 2.7 thousand people — even though United States holds more of our records for it.
How common is Arlen compared with other names?
In Kyrgyzstan, Arlen is the 973rd most common given name of 140,295 given names recorded there.
Is Arlen a male or female name?
Arlen is a female name in our records. Opposite-gender entries fall within the cross-gender noise we measure in the source data, so we don't report them as usage.
What does the name Arlen mean?
Recorded meaning: an alteration of the German surname Erlen.
